English: U.S. Secretary of State John Kerry and German Foreign Minister Frank-Walter Steinmeier pose for a photos after addressing reporters at a joint press conference at the U.S. Department of State in Washington, D.C., on February 29, 2016. [State Department photo/ Public Domain] |
